Blue Bears Edge Bowie State in One-Point Thriller

Salisbury, NC – The Blue Bears earned a dramatic victory on Saturday, defeating Bowie State 17–16 in a CIAA opener that came down to the wire.

After trailing early, the Blue Bears exploded in the second quarter with 17 unanswered points, including two touchdown passes from Elijah Alexander and a clutch 43-yard field goal by Jason Zapata as time expired in the half.

Game Highlights:
  • Bowie State struck first with a 17-yard field goal midway through the first quarter to take a 3–0 lead.
  • Livingstone responded early in the second quarter when Elijah Alexander connected with Ronald Lindsey for an 18-yard touchdown pass, giving the Blue Bears a 7–3 advantage.
  • Bowie answered with a 30-yard touchdown pass to reclaim the lead at 10–7, but Livingstone wasn't done.
  • Alexander found Tavion Jackson for a 26-yard score to put the Blue Bears back on top, 14–10.
  • Just before halftime, Jason Zapata drilled a 43-yard field goal to extend the lead to 17–10.
  • Bowie State made one final push in the fourth quarter with a 31-yard touchdown pass, but their two-point conversion attempt failed—securing the 17–16 win for Livingstone.
Livingstone's defense held strong in the final quarter, stopping Bowie State's two-point conversion attempt and preserving the narrow lead. The Blue Bears recorded five sacks, including four from Kenyon Garner, and controlled possession for over 32 minutes.
